Just to rule out potential issues with cables and the YAGH itself, is anyone successfully getting either a record trigger or timecode from a GH4 via the YAGH interface? I get record trigger from the mini HDMI directly but not through the YAGH. The GH4 shows timecode from my mixer but not on the Pix-E5. (2.4 and 1.1 firmware, HDMI record out, etc. ) Video Devices says they have not tested the Pix-E5 with the YAGH. They don't understand why the signal protocol would change from the mini interface to the YAGH and I don't either. The Pix-E5 sees the 4k 10 bit picture just fine.
 
Is there a need for the YAGH when you get full use of the PIX-E5 with the GH4? It seems like a needless complication in this instance.

I haven't tested the YAGH with it, but can confirm that the PIX-E5 works perfectly with the GH4 through direct connection.

Yes as I stated I get the record trigger signal via the mini port, however my goal is to get the timecode from my mixer as well as use the YAGH balanced audio inputs.
 
My solution: Configure timecode on mixer as rec run, send timecode from mixer to Pix-E5 LTC In, configure Pix to use TC from the LTC port and to record on TC start, add a delay on the LTC signal to account for the latency between the mix audio (and video) and the mixer tracks.
